A factory produces 1200 units of product X in a day. The
production rate of product Y is 25% more than that of product X. In the next 5 days, the factory produces product Y at a rate 15% higher than the current rate of production of product X. How many units of product Y will be produced in total over the next 5 days?Solution
Production rate of product X = 1200 units per day. Production rate of product Y = 1200 * (1 + 0.25) = 1500 units per day. For the next 5 days, the production rate of product Y is increased by 15%. New production rate = 1500 * (1 + 0.15) = 1500 * 1.15 = 1725 units per day. Total units of product Y produced in the next 5 days = 1725 * 5 = 8625 units. Therefore, the total units of product Y will be 8625 units. Answer: d) 8625
